About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Dortmund Airport (DTM), Dortmund, North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any and Letfotar Airport (MOM), Moudjeria, Mauritania would travel a Great Circle distance of 2,579 miles (or 4,151 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Dortmund Airport and Letfotar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Dortmund Airport (DTM):
- The furthest airport from Dortmund Airport (DTM) is Chatham Islands (CHT), which is located 11,872 miles (19,106 kilometers) away in Waitangi, Chatham Islands, New Zealand.
- In addition to being known as "Dortmund Airport", another name for DTM is "Flughafen Dortmund".
- Because of Dortmund Airport's relatively low elevation of 425 feet, planes can take off or land at Dortmund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- Commercial service was restored in 1979 with daily flights to Munich by Reise- und Industrieflug.
- At one time Eurowings had its headquarters, the Dortmund Administrative Center, at the airport.
- Since 2006 it has been carrying the name "Dortmund Airport 21", in reference to the fact that Dortmund's utility company, DSW21, is its major shareholder.
- The first mass carrier at Dortmund Airport was Air Berlin, which began flights to London, Milan, and Vienna in 2002, supplementing its leisure routes to the Mediterranean.
- The closest airport to Dortmund Airport (DTM) is Düsseldorf Airport (DUS), which is located 40 miles (64 kilometers) WSW of DTM.
- Dortmund Airport is served by an express bus to Dortmund main station, a shuttle bus to the nearby railway station Holzwickede/Dortmund Flughafen, a bus to the city's metro line U47, as well as a bus to the city of Unna.
- Dortmund Airport (DTM) currently has only 1 runway.
